Country overviewA magnitude M4.8 earthquake was recorded near Maluku (Indonesia) on September 12, 2026 at 06:14 UTC. The earthquake originated at an intermediate depth of about 134 km. Earthquakes of this magnitude are clearly felt; minor damage to vulnerable buildings is possible.
The data is provided by USGS and cross-checked across seismological networks. Indonesia: over the past 24 hours, QuakeMap24 logged 29 earthquakes, the strongest at M6.6.
Intermediate-depth quakes are felt across a wider area but usually cause less surface damage.
